Filler

[1] Paste usually with a polyester base which, when mixed with a hardener, forms a surface which can be sanded smooth and is suitable for repairs to dented or rusted bodywork. Also called "filler paste".
[2] A primer filler.
[3] an inert material added to paper, resins, and other substances to modify their properties and improve quality.
[4] An opening through which some liquid can be poured (i.e., oil or gasoline).

What are Car Financial Responsibility Laws?

This is the law that says you have to prove that you are financially able to pay for anything you may be responsible for while driving your car. The easiest way of showing this is by having car insurance and that is what the majority of people do to comply with this law. Some states to have other ways that one can show financial responsibility such as giving a large cash deposit for the DMV.
